Bozeman-forum threads on January driving conditions are direct that winter here demands real preparation: long stretches of highway between towns with little civilization in between, and posters recommend carrying tire chains and confirming good winter tires before setting out regardless of how clear the forecast looks that morning. Stormy stretches are a real possibility though by no means guaranteed for any given week. Regulars flag January and February as the likeliest months to hit a genuine subzero cold snap, meaningfully more probable than in March. The upside: this is peak season for nearby Bridger Bowl and Big Sky skiing, powder conditions at their best precisely because of the cold. Anyone driving on to Yellowstone is warned road closures and reduced access are standard for the season. The record: a brutal 1.4C by day dropping to -9.6C at night, 25mm across 6.5 days, a notably high 38.5cm of fresh snowfall, 77 percent humidity and 6.7 hours of sun.

Bozeman-forum threads on a February visit describe Explore Rentals as genuinely the only local agency putting dedicated snow tires on its entire winter fleet, worth considering when renting a car. Regulars call only the Gardiner to Cooke City entrance road genuinely open to wheeled vehicles in February, several posters naming a snow coach or snowmobile tour as required for the rest of Yellowstone. Posters call snow coach day tours genuinely reaching Canyon, covering the Upper and Lower Falls, and Norris Geyser Basin, several regulars naming these the standard winter routes. Regulars call Bozeman genuinely not a great day-trip base for the park, several threads naming a roughly four-hour snow coach ride from Mammoth to the snow lodge as the reason. Posters recommend real planning around snow coach schedules, several regulars calling this standard given how limited winter access is. The record: 1.6C days, -10.1C nights, 32mm across over 8 days and 74 percent humidity.

Forum posters are blunt that March is still properly winter in Bozeman - plentiful snow, ski areas still fully open, and genuinely no way to predict whether a given week brings deep cold or a lucky stretch of sunny 50sF. Heavy snow is entirely possible even into early April. Posters who can shift their trip to April are generally advised to do so, though a March visit can still work out well with flexible plans - build in slack to delay a drive a day if a storm rolls through, since main roads stay well-plowed but can see temporary closures during a bad system. One planning note specific to this month: both Yellowstone and Glacier National Park are essentially still closed, each keeping only a small stretch of road open through winter.

May here is spring in name only. Bozeman-forum regulars describe a month that can be gorgeous with a short afternoon shower or blustery with snow, sometimes in the same week, and they tell visitors to bring layers, a hat and gloves because whatever the afternoon does, the nights are cold. Roads are generally fine by May and the valley is greening up. For Yellowstone the dates matter: the south entrance opens around 9 May and most main roads are open by then, with Dunraven Pass between Canyon and Tower the usual exception - and any of them can shut again for a day after a spring storm. Trails in the backcountry hold snow well past the opening. The record: 18.3C days, 4.5C nights, 11.2 precipitation days, 16.5cm of snow, 11.7 hours of sun.

Bozeman-forum threads on May-into-June weather describe a month split by a rough date: early June can be gorgeous with just the usual short afternoon shower, or it can turn blustery enough to bring snow, and posters are candid that June is one of the wettest months of the year here - one regular's standing advice is simply to come after June 25th, when the weather turns reliably good. The upside through the unsettled stretch: the sun doesn't set until after 9pm, so even a rainy day still runs long. Trails at higher elevations stay snow-covered well into the month regardless of what the valley floor is doing. The record: 24.2C days, 8.9C nights, 70mm of rain across 9.7 days, a touch of snowfall still possible and 13 hours of sun - warm at the surface, unsettled underneath, and better the later in June you land.

Bozeman-forum threads comparing June and July land firmly on July as the better bet, June still carrying real odds of a wet, unsettled stretch while July settles into warm, mostly clear days ideal for rafting, paddleboarding and getting out on the water generally. Posters describe nights cooling off substantially even after a warm afternoon, mountain-town temperature swings that make an evening layer worth packing regardless of how hot the day ran. The Gallatin Divide and surrounding trails are repeatedly named a top summer backpacking draw, conditions here about as reliable as this part of Montana gets. Regulars call July the genuine start of the settled summer weather window that holds through August before things start turning again in September. The record: 29.4C days feeling like 29C, 12.1C nights, 56 percent humidity, a clean 46 AQI and 13.7 hours of sun.

Montana's forum calls September a favorite among regulars for exactly the reason you'd expect — good weather, real crowds already thinned from summer — while warning it can swing hard: one visitor described 75°F hiking weather followed by snow the very next day. Layers are the universal advice, not just a light jacket.

Bozeman-forum threads on an October visit describe hiking and biking as still rewarding on a good sunny day, posters calling conditions capable of turning cold and blustery with real snow flurries just as easily. Regulars call state park campgrounds typically open through October even as higher-elevation sites close after Labor Day, a real option for camping this late in the season. Regulars call Yellowstone's interior roads closed on the first Monday of November, posters suggesting late-October dates like the twenty-fourth or twenty-fifth as still reasonably safe. Posters call local services genuinely starting to shut down through October, several businesses running reduced hours ahead of the off-season. Regulars recommend checking Bozone.com for a current events calendar, a real resource for planning around whatever's still running this time of year. The record: 14.8C days feeling like 14C, 0.6C nights, an extraordinarily high 55.4mm across nearly 9 days and 58 percent humidity.
